| 1 | Impact of COVID-19 lockdown on hospital admissions for epistaxis in Germany显示文摘BACKGROUND Reports of a decrease in hospital admissions during the coronavirus disease 2019(COVID-19)lockdown period have raised concerns about delayed or missed diagnoses and treatments for non-COVID-19-related illnesses.AIM To investigate the impact of the COVID-19 pandemic-induced lockdown and its end on hospital admissions of patients with epistaxis in Germany.METHODS A retrospective analysis based on the national database of the Hospital Remuneration System was used to compare hospital admissions during defined time periods between 2019 and 2022 with the lockdown period as the reference period.This was done on a weekly basis before,during,and after the lockdown.An Interrupted Time Series was used as the analysis method.RESULTS In our analysis,we included 26183 patients.The implementation of the lockdown led to a substantial reduction in the overall occurrence of epistaxis among patients(P<0.05).This effect was most pronounced in the age group of 0-39 years,where the decrease was highly significant(P<0.001).However,there was no change observed in patients aged 80 years and older(not significant).With the end of the lockdown period,the overall number of patients,especially in the youngest age group,increased abruptly and significantly(P<0.01).CONCLUSION During the lockdown period,there was a decrease in hospital admissions for younger patients with epistaxis,possibly due to the fear of COVID-19 exposure.We also conclude that the severity of epistaxis was not underestimated in the elderly during the pandemic. | Adrian Hoenle Martin Wagner Stephan Lorenz Helmut Steinhart | 2023 | World Journal of Methodology2023,13,5: | 0 |
| 2 | Fast Evaporation Enabled Ultrathin Polymer Coatings on Nanoporous Substrates for Highly Permeable Membranes显示文摘Thin polymer coatings covering on porous substrates are a common composite structure required in numerous applications,including membrane separation,and there is a strong need to push the coating thicknesses down to the nanometer scale to maximize the performances.However,producing such ultrathin polymer coatings in a facile and efficient way remains a big challenge.Here,uniform ultrathin polymer covering films(UPCFs)are realized by a facile and general approach based on rapid solvent evaporation.By fast evaporating dilute polymer solutions spread on the surface of porous substrates,we obtain ultrathin coatings(down to30 nm)exclusively on the top surface of porous substrates,forming UPCFs with a block copolymer of polystyrene-blockpoly(2-vinyl pyridine)at room temperature or a homopolymer of poly(vinyl alcohol)(PVA)at elevated temperatures.Upon selective swelling of the block copolymer and crosslinking of PVA,we obtain highly permeable membranes delivering2–10 times higher permeance in ultrafiltration and pervaporation than state-of-the-art membranes with comparable selectivities.We have invented a very convenient but highly efficient process for the direct preparation of defective-free ultrathin coatings on porous substrates,which is extremely desired in different fields in addition to membrane separation. | Xiansong Shi Lei Wang Nina Yan Zhaogen Wang Leiming Guo Martin Steinhart Yong Wang | 2021 | The Innovation2021,2,1: | 0 |
